The maximum power dissipation of the INA331IDGKTG4 is 670mW at 25°C, but it can be derated based on the ambient temperature and thermal resistance of the package.
To minimize noise and ensure accurate measurements, it's recommended to follow proper PCB layout techniques such as separating analog and digital grounds, using a solid ground plane, and keeping sensitive analog signals away from noisy digital signals.
The recommended input impedance for the INA331IDGKTG4 is 1kΩ to 10kΩ to ensure accurate measurements and minimize noise.
The INA331IDGKTG4 is designed for low-frequency applications up to 50kHz. For high-frequency applications, it's recommended to use a different amplifier with a higher bandwidth, such as the INA189 or INA219.
The gain error and offset voltage of the INA331IDGKTG4 can be calculated using the formulas provided in the datasheet, taking into account the input voltage range, gain setting, and temperature.
